WebAccording to the U.S. Census Bureau, Iowa had a debt of $6,120,464,000 in fiscal year 2015. The state debt per capita was $1,960. This ranked Iowa 37th among the states in debt and 40th in per capita debt. The total state debt owned by the 50 states was $1.15 trillion with a per capita debt of $3,582.
